    Can you still get a pizza sauce stain out of a white shirt after washing it in a cold wash, but not drying it?

    Spray and WashCan you still get a pizza sauce stain out of a white shirt after washing it in a cold wash, but not drying it?
    Most likely. Apply shampoo (I use the cheapest I can find, usually Suave) or dishwashing detergent (like Dawn, not dishwasher detergent) to the area, hold for several hours, rewash. You may need some peroxygen or perborate bleach (like Clorox 2 or Snowy or Oxyclean) if it doesn't all come out in the second wash.





    The orangey stain from tomato products is a mixture of carotenoids, pigments that are not water soluble, but dissolve quite nicely in non-polar substances like fats, or with a good detergent.Can you still get a pizza sauce stain out of a white shirt after washing it in a cold wash, but not drying it?
    Kay is spot on! She forgot to say that behind the tomato and its pigment is the grease from the pizza. That is what is holding some of the stain in. Dishwashing liquid or shampoo may do it but, if not, and BEFORE bleaching, try some 409 or any household grease cutter. Let it sit on the stain and work it in then rewash and continue with Kay's advice.

    How do I get chewing gum out of a nylon dry-weave shirt? Not a new stain... I washed it a couple of times.?

    My hubby recently washed a shirt and forgot to remove the gum in his pocket. This is a Nike dry weave shirt and the gum is ground in. Any advise?How do I get chewing gum out of a nylon dry-weave shirt? Not a new stain... I washed it a couple of times.?
    Get hold of some WD40 and spray liberally on the chewing gum. Make sure you do this while the garment is on a non porous surface that won't be damaged.





    Spray enough on until the fabric is visibly ';wet';. Leave it for a few minutes and the gum will scrub off with a dry cloth. Remove as much as you can and then repeat.





    The WD40 shouldn't leave a stain but it may smell slightly. This can be removed by washing.





    It might be advisable to test on a hidden area in case it damages the fabric. This should not happen as I have used this on a wool/polyester dinner jacket with no problems.How do I get chewing gum out of a nylon dry-weave shirt? Not a new stain... I washed it a couple of times.?

    I think you may have some bad slides...the drum that the clothes tumble in is driven on one end and on the door end are two or three inexpensive slides. It could have something to do with the chap stick especially if it melted and soaked up into the pads the tumbler glides on. If you wipe out the dryer when hot and the grease comes back that may be it. I called my friend the Maytag Repairman and he ordered some up pronto...here's a link about the part I'm referring to. Other brands also have slides, or glides...
